请问各位大侠: 怎么把sql server 2005 导出数据到execl 中,我用的SQL是 EXEC master..xp_cmdshell 'bcp bannreport.dbo.FCiu out "d:\aaa.xls" -c -S"192.168.10.15" -U"sa" -P"baan"' 在sql server 2005 下面有如下内容: NULL 开始复制... 1000 行成功地成批复制到主文件。总计接收: 1000 1000 行成功地成批复制到主文件。总计接收: 2000 1000 行成功地成批复制到主文件。总计接收: 3000 1000 行成功地成批复制到主文件。总计接收: 4000 1000 行成功地成批复制到主文件。总计接收: 5000 1000 行成功地成批复制到主文件。总计接收: 6000 NULL 已复制 6873 行。 网络数据包大小(字节): 4096 总时钟时间(毫秒) : 78 平均值: (每秒 88115.38 行。) NULL 但为什么在D盘下就是找不到导出来的文件了!
这个问题第1个回答:
刷新一下再看看
这个问题第2个回答:
應該已經存在 在運行處輸入:d:\aaa.xls
这个问题第3个回答:
还是不行啊
这个问题第4个回答:
知道了,因为数据库不在本地,把导出的数据放到服务器上去了!
|